What companies run services between Montpellier, France and Noli, Italy?

You can take a train from Montpellier Saint-Roch to Noli via Marseille St Charles, Nice-Ville, Ventimiglia, Finale Ligure Marina, and Finale Ligure in around 9h 21m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Montpellier - Sabines Bus Station to Noli via Marseille, Gare de Marseille-Saint-Charles, Savona, Savona, Finale Ligure Marina, and Finale Ligure in around 9h 51m.
